A 20-ohm resistor and a 30-ohm resistor are connected in parallel. What is the total resistance?

a.50 ohms
b.12 ohms
c.25 ohms
d.10 ohms

Explanation

For two resistors in parallel, R total = (R1 x R2) / (R1 + R2) = (20 x 30) / 50 = 600 / 50 = 12 ohms. The 50-ohm answer adds them as if they were in series, and 25 ohms averages them, but total parallel resistance is always less than the smallest branch resistance.
